On the heels of releasing “Doe-Active” and “Perfume,” Harlem rapper A$AP Ferg gets political on a new Clams Casino-produced song, “Talk It.” Ferg raps:
“All I ever wanted was a Clams Casino beat, to talk about oppression that’s repressing my peeps/ ridin’ round in that gray hooptie with my Uncle T, NWA blastin’, we screamin’ ‘fuck the police’ (fuck ’em)/Cause they don’t give two shits about me/I mean we when/I say Ferguson they talk about me/Little brown, Mike Brown/ Shot down in Missouri.”
A$AP Ferg also goes on to address his haters who have been praying and preying on his downfall.
Earlier this month, Ferg and YG teamed up on a West Coast vs. East Coast-inspired banger titled “This Side.” The two are scheduled to go on the road for the “Best Coast Connection Tour.”
